Fruity extra-virgin olive oil 1/4 cup whole milk 1/4 cup cold water, plus more if needed ... Pineau des Charentes is a vin de liqueur of the Cognac Region. Typically, the alcohol level is 17 to 18 percent. It is made by adding year-old Cognac straight from the cask to grape juice just at fermentation, then by maturing the cuvée in a cask until the July ...
